Nestled in the picturesque town of Andermatt, the Suvorov Monument stands as a testament to history and heroism. This striking memorial commemorates the remarkable crossing of the Swiss Alps by Russian troops under General Suvorov in 1799, showcasing not just military achievement but also the breathtaking backdrop of the Swiss landscape. Tourists flock to this site not only for its historical significance but also for the stunning views it offers, making it a must-see destination for anyone visiting the region.
